
Verizon Wireless is also preparing to launch Motorola’s brand new Android Honeycomb tablet ‘Xoom‘ on their network. The device will become available from February 24th for $599.99 with a new 2-year contract agreement and a data plan of at least $20 per month or for $799.99 without any contract. As a quick reminder, the Motorola Xoom sports a 10.1-inch 1280 x 800 touchscreen display, a 1GHz dual-core Tegra 2 processor, a 2.0-megapixel front-facing camera, a 5.0-megapixel rear-facing camera with dual LED flash, a 1GB DDR2 RAM, a 32GB of storage space, 3G, WiFi, Bluetooth 2.1 + EDR, 720p HD video recording capabilities, 1080p Full HD video playback support and runs on Android 3.0 Honeycomb OS. Verizon Wireless has recently unveiled the LG Chocolate Touch that comes jam packed with a touchscreen LCD display, a 3.2-megapixel camera with built in digital zoom and a range of software editing features. The phone also adopts an FM radio with 12 presets and an access to a range of social networking sites including Twitter, Facebook and MySpace. The LG Chocolate Touch is available for $79.99 after a $50 mail-in rebate with a new two-year customer agreement on a Nationwide Calling Plan. [Verizon Wireless via Upcoming Cell Phones]

Verizon will release the highly anticipated Motorola Droid on November 6th, 2009 for $199 with a new two-year customer agreement after a $100 mail-in rebate. For your info, the smartphone features a Cortex A8 processor with a 16GB of memory, a 3.7-inch LCD display, a 5MP digicam, a slide out QWERTY keyboard, Bluetooth, and Google Android 2.0 OS. The Motorola Droid is currently available for pre-order at the Verizon website. [Verizon via Upcoming Cell Phones]

Verizon Wireless and Casio have joined together to launch the new Casio Exilim C721 that has a 180-degree rotating display, a 5MP camera with a 3x optical zoom, a LED flash, Auto Focus, and Image Stabilizer. Available in silver color, the camera phone is priced at $279.99 after a $50.00 mail-in rebate with a new two-year customer agreement. [Slashphone via Upcoming Cell Phones]
